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
998146027 23733 226970005
8942644 7430 60661082423
8942644 7430 60661082423
423 970532742 025
All about undefined
Interested in learning more?
8942644 7430 60661082423
423 970532742 025
See more
666317 643009243 98
59943160 310110623 64562357
See more
24 192411 54
20865699695 01175640 7179410
See more